Foxtable(狐表)用户栏目专家坐堂 → 狐爸请看一下


  共有1619人关注过本帖树形打印复制链接

主题:狐爸请看一下

帅哥哟,离线,有人找我吗?
bobolan521
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:637 积分:7362 威望:0 精华:1 注册:2013/11/26 7:49:00
狐爸请看一下  发帖心情 Post By:2016/11/11 8:37:00 [只看该作者]


Dim Builder As New ADOXBuilder("nwnd") '要指定数据源名称
Dim
tbl As ADOXTable
Builder.Open()
tbl = Builder.NewTable(
"订单") '创建表
With
tbl
    .AddColumn(
"日期" ,ADOXType.DateTime)
    .AddColumn(
"产品" ,ADOXType.String, 12)
    .AddColumn(
"客户" ,ADOXType.String, 20)
    .AddColumn(
"数量" ,ADOXType.Integer)
    .AddColumn(
"备注" ,ADOXType.Text)
End With
Builder.AddTable(tbl)
'增加表
Builder.Close()



软件能不能改进一下,执行了上面的这段代码后,第二次打开项目就把订单表给加载到项目里,


或者执行datatables.load("订单") ,就马上把订单表加载到项目里。


特别是项目交付后,可以让用户自己在软件里增加表了。



 回到顶部
帅哥哟,离线,有人找我吗?
有点色
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:13837 积分:69650 威望:0 精华:0 注册:2016/11/1 14:42:00
  发帖心情 Post By:2016/11/11 8:48:00 [只看该作者]

 增加表,不能写代码设置事件也没什么用。

 

 你可以在afterOpenProject那里直接引入表 http://www.foxtable.com/webhelp/scr/1279.htm

 


 回到顶部